Understanding Robot Cleaners
Robot cleaners, frequently described as robotic vacuum cleaners, are autonomous devices created to perform cleaning tasks with very little human intervention. They usually navigate through spaces using sensing units, brushes, and suction power to collect dust, dirt, and debris. The evolution of this innovation has caused considerable developments, making robot cleaners more effective than ever.
Secret Features to Look For in a Robot Cleaner
When looking for the very best robot cleaner, consumers must think about a number of key features that affect efficiency and usability. Below is a list of necessary factors:
- Suction Power: Strong suction is important for reliable cleaning, especially for homes with animals or hard-to-reach carpets.
- Battery Life: A longer battery life guarantees that the robot can cover a bigger location before requiring a recharge.

- Smart Features: Wi-Fi connection, app control, and voice command functionalities boost user experience and convenience.
- Filter System: HEPA filters can trap irritants and dust, making them perfect for allergic reaction sufferers.
- Size and Design: A slim profile enables the robot to tidy under furniture easily.
- Mopping Functionality: Some designs combine vacuuming with mopping abilities, providing a comprehensive tidy.
Top Robot Cleaners of 2023
To help customers in selecting the perfect robot cleaner, the following table showcases a few of the best designs readily available in 2023, highlighting their essential functions and prices.
Design | Suction Power | Battery Life | Navigation Type | Smart Features | Price Range |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
iRobot Roomba i7+ | 1700 Pa | 75 mins | Smart Mapping | Yes (app + voice) | ₤ 799 |
Roborock S7 | 2500 Pa | 180 minutes | Lidar Mapping | Yes (app + voice) | ₤ 649 |
Ecovacs Deebot T8 | 3000 Pa | 240 mins | Lidar + Visual | Yes (app + voice, electronic camera) | ₤ 899 |
Neato D8 | 2000 Pa | 90 mins | Laser Mapping | Yes (app + voice) | ₤ 599 |
Shark IQ Robot | 1800 Pa | 90 minutes | Smart Mapping | Yes (app + voice) | ₤ 449 |

FAQs About Robot Cleaners
What is the typical lifespan of a robot vacuum?
The average life-span of a robot vacuum is around 5 to 10 years, depending upon usage, maintenance, and build quality.
Do robot vacuum work on carpets?
Yes, a lot of robot vacuum work successfully on carpets. However, those with higher suction power will carry out much better on thick carpets.
Can I manage a robot vacuum with my smartphone?
Lots of contemporary robot vacuum cleaners offer smart device compatibility. Users can control their gadgets, schedule cleanings, and receive notifications through dedicated mobile apps.
How do I maintain my robot vacuum?
Regular maintenance consists of clearing the dust bin, cleaning the brushes and filters, and making sure the sensors are totally free of debris. Following the maker's standards for care and maintenance will prolong the device's life.
